Cardano's ADA token jumped toward $0.235 on a scaling milestone, then slid back near $0.22 as liquidation data showed leveraged longs took the hit. Open interest sits near $506.5 million, and futures liquidated roughly $899,000 in 24 hours, split nine to one against long positions.

A trader watching the CoinGlass terminal at four in the morning UTC would have seen ADA wipe out more long positions in twelve hours than in the previous four days combined, even as the coin stayed up on the week. ADA sat near $0.2199 at writing time, down roughly 3.5% on the day, less than 48 hours after it tagged $0.2350 on a Cardano scaling headline.

What pushed ADA to $0.235

The Cardano Foundation confirmed that the Leios public testnet, built with Input Output Group and Intersect, is now live for stake pool operators to test. Simulation work points toward the 100 to 1,000 transactions per second range once the design ships to mainnet, up from roughly 4.5 kilobytes per second today, at least on paper.

That landed days after a September 15 announcement that the Foundation joined a Mastercard program looking at cross-border settlement, plus a September 7 mainnet deployment of node 11.1.1. Three pieces of good news inside two weeks is unusual for this chain, and price reacted the way a crowded, thin order book usually reacts to a genuine catalyst: it overshot.

The weekly chart still reads bearish

ADA topped near $1.32 in 2025 and has carved a sequence of lower highs since, a structure that stays intact until a prior lower high gets reclaimed with a close. Price remains compressed against the multi-month low near $0.145, a level that keeps getting tested but not fully swept. On the daily range, that low sits below a resistance shelf near $0.305 that has turned price away twice already this year, with ADA now sitting roughly in the middle of that box.

Liquidation data names the crowd that got hurt

Open interest on ADA sits near $506.5 million, and the Binance long-to-short account ratio reads 2.01, meaning retail traders ran roughly two long positions for every short into the top. The rekt numbers confirm who paid for the overshoot: over the past 24 hours, ADA futures liquidated roughly $899,000, split between $811,000 in long positions and just $88,000 in shorts, a nine-to-one imbalance.

In the twelve hours around the drop from $0.235, longs alone absorbed $689,650 of that damage. Traders opened leveraged longs into the spike, got trapped when momentum stalled, and were flushed out on the retrace.

Bitcoin slipped toward the low $80,000s the same session even as exchange reserves climbed, and a broader move saw altcoins reclaim their 200-day averages. ADA's next move likely hinges on whether the $0.2150 to $0.2220 pocket holds through the next few sessions; a clean loss of $0.2130 would hand control back to sellers and put the $0.195 base back on the table.
